scratchy
adj. B2 Upper Intermediate US //ˈskɹætʃi// UK //skɹˈætʃi// scratchy Informal
adj. having a surface that feels rough or itchy. It can also describe a voice that sounds hoarse or a sound that is not smooth.
adj. having a rough, uneven, or irritating surface; also describes a voice or sound that lacks smoothness or clarity. Often used to describe physical textures or vocal qualities.
The new wool sweater is very scratchy against my skin.
After losing her voice for three days, she had a scratchy, raspy sound that made it hard to speak clearly.
The technician noted that the audio recording was scratchy in the second half, likely due to a minor dust buildup on the analog tape head.
From scratch + -y.
